This is something you simply have to experience. St. Petersburg’s metro opened in 1955 and it is considered to be the most attractive, elegant and deepest (105 meter below ground) in the world. Almost all of the station are a complete piece of art. Some say it is the palace of the people. It is unique to experience its escalators going deep into the ground and to witness the art all around you. Take the metro from Primorskaya to Nevsky Prospekt to get from the port area to the city centre.


Our Address:

Primorskaya, St. Petersburg


59.94801456200191, 30.234377272487336